Explanation/Reference:To remember which type of cable you should use, follow these tips:- To connect two serial interfaces of 2 routers we use serial cable To specify when we use crossover cableor straight-through cable, we should remember:Group 1: Router, Host, Server Group 2: Hub, SwitchOnedevice in group 1 + One device in group 2: use straight-through cable Two devices in the same group: usecrossover cableFor example: we use straight-through cable to connect switch to router, switch to host, hub to host, hub toserver... and we use crossover cable to connect switch to switch, switch to hub, router to router, host tohost... )

Explanation/Reference:If we have many entries matching for next hop ip address then the router will choose the one with mostspecific path to send the packet. This is called the "longest match" rule, the route with the most bits in themask set to "1 will be chosen to route packet.

Explanation/Reference:A simple way to find out which layer is having problem is to remember this rule: "the first statement is forLayer 1, the last statement is for Layer 2 and if Layer 1 is down then surely Layer 2 will be down too", soyou have to check Layer 1 before checking Layer 2. For example, from the output "Serial0/1 is up, lineprotocol is down" we know that it is a layer 2 problem because the first statement (Serial0/1 is up) is goodwhile the last statement (line protocol is down) is bad. For the statement "Serial0/1 is down, line protocol isdown", both layers are down so the problem belongs to Layer 1.There is only one special case with the statement ".... is administrator down, line protocol is down". In thiscase, we know that the port is currently disabled and shut down by the administrators.
